Output 6b21ef70d143b5c25da02dd34002f907d26324529ae81b9f8eb56169eb71bdff:0

value
679086
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 131d6f1a4d4e2ce6e750c62bf318a31a3940785a OP_EQUALVERIFY OP_CHECKSIG
address
12k56kmWREQNSSiCHU7gt6kuHbThwWgJhh
transaction
6b21ef70d143b5c25da02dd34002f907d26324529ae81b9f8eb56169eb71bdff
confirmations
413936
spent
true